It is appropriate to mention that this is the first visit by an top White House official in India under the Trump administration.
His visit to India follows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s visit to America in February, where he met Tulsi Gabbard and called him a “strong voter” of Indo-US friendship.
One of the first engagement of PM Modi in the US was a meeting with Tulsi Gabard, which was recently confirmed as Director of the National Intelligence Director under the administration of President Trump.
Gabbard’s nomination was approved by the Senate in 52–48 votes, most of the Republican supported his previous reservation on his previous comments on Russia, his meeting with former Syrian President Bashar al-Assad and his previous support for the whistlebloor Edward Snowden. Kentaki Senator Mich McConel was the only Republican to vote against his confirmation.
During his meeting, PM Modi recalled his earlier conversation with Gabbard and congratulated him for his new role. Their discussion focused on strengthening bilateral intelligence cooperation, especially in anti-terrorism, cyber security, emerging threats and strategic intelligence. He exchanged ideas on regional and global development, confirming his commitment to a safe, stable and rule-based international order.
